Kwanzaa focuses on seven core principles (expressed in Swahili as Nguzo Saba); each principle linked with each day of the seven-day celebration. Kwanzaa is not a religious holiday, nor is it meant to replace Christmas. Kwanzaa occurs at the same time every year, and like Hanukkah, is a week-long celebration.
